While Llanfairfechan Train Station captures the charm of simplicity, it offers several essential amenities to ensure a seamless travel experience. Though there is no ticket office or ticket machines on site, travelers can securely purchase and plan their journeys online. For those needing assistance or information about departures, there's a dedicated helpline available.
The station prioritizes accessibility, offering step-free access to platforms via convenient pathways and ramps, making it simple for passengers with mobility needs to navigate between Chester-bound Platform 1 and Holyhead-bound Platform 2. Public seating is provided, ensuring a comfortable wait for your train, though there are no waiting rooms or first-class lounges.

At Gobowen station, you'll find a range of facilities that cater to the modern traveler. From 07:30 to 15:00 during weekdays and reduced hours on Saturdays, the ticket office provides personal assistance to help plan your travel. If you prefer a quicker approach, ticket machines are available which accept major debit and credit cards, although they do not accept cash. For those with online purchases, there is easy ticket collection at the machine, ensuring a smooth start to your journey.
The station is also equipped with necessary amenities like customer help points, where you can get information or assistance. Although it lacks accessible toilets and baby changing facilities, it ensures safe travel with the availability of CCTV surveillance. Accessibility is partially addressed with step-free access to both platforms and accessible ticket machines for ease of travel.
Gobowen station is well-connected with various transportation links. Although there is no car hire service, the railway replacement bus stop is conveniently located at the station entrance for seamless continued travel. For cyclists, there are 10 sheltered bicycle stands but currently, there’s no cycle hire available at the station.
For those with accessibility needs, while the station excels with features like ramps for train access, it does lack accessible taxis and designated pick-up points for impaired mobility—a consideration to keep in mind if this applies to you. Passengers in need of assistance can utilize the Passenger Assist service by booking in advance to ensure a comfortable journey.
